It was bound to happen, but not in the way many expected. The Lions held on strong against the Kansas City Chiefs, falling on the final drive. Chris explains how there's no such thing as a moral victory, but now we know exactly who the Lions are and what their strengths will be moving forward. Ryan sees the team in there each week, and Jeremy sees consistency emerging. The crew dives into the good in Justin Coleman, the bad in the final goal line stand against the Chiefs, and the ugly with the Kerryon Johnson fumble and ref debacle. Mailbag crunches through a lot of reader questions, including whether the Lions should be in the hunt for Jalen Ramsey. Learn more about your ad choices. Visit megaphone.fm/adchoices
